To answer this honestly
It's the idea a title, position, and/or "legacy" doesn't have to be tied exclusively to an individual. People get hung up on Peter Parker as if he's the only person who is and can be Spider Man, like how people thought Naked Snake was the only one who could be Big Boss. Instead, Miles' story and interactions with the multiverse Spiderpeople proved "anyone can be Spider Man" ; Miles in particular being from the *same dimension* as a Peter Parker yet is still Spider Man. Likewise, Venom Snake at the end of the day eas every bit as Big Boss as Naked Snake, both of them not only sharing but making up the Legacy, the "Legend." There's also the fourth wall bit, where ITSV's message meant the kids of today have the capacity to be heroes like Spider Man, MGSV's message was the real Big Boss was the player the whole time

>tl;dr Both movies share the message of shared identities/legacies and how it can be acquired by anyone who steps up to the plate
